ATLUS and SEGA have released a new trailer for Shin Megami Tensei V: Vengeance, titled ‘The Ultimate Beginning’. It was previously announced that this trailer would be released tonight, with Atlus stating this video will act as the third trailer. Take a look below:
Shin Megami Tensei V: Vengeance is an expanded and enhanced version of Shin Megami Tensei V, which launched exclusively for Nintendo Switch in 2021. This enhanced version offers two complete story paths, with loads of new content previously not available. Of course, both visuals and frame rate have been enhanced for this release, allowing for 4K 60fps on newer platforms.
The title was officially unveiled in February of this year. Dozens of new demons, locations, and decisions have been added, with many being part of the new Canon of Vengeance storyline. This new trailer today focuses heavily on this storyline, with many cutscenes and characters who are entirely new to the game.

Shin Megami Tensei V: Vengeance launches on June 14 for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, and PC via Steam worldwide.
